The Evolution of HydroGeo Modeling: A Game-Changer in Water Resources Management

HydroGeo modeling is a dynamic field that combines hydrology, geology, and geographic information systems (GIS) to simulate and predict the behavior of water resources. This technology has revolutionized how we manage and protect water systems, making it an essential tool for professionals and policymakers addressing water scarcity and pollution.

# Advancements in HydroGeo Modeling

One of the most significant advancements in HydroGeo modeling is the integration of artificial intelligence (AI) and machine learning (ML). These technologies enable models to learn from historical data and predict future trends more accurately. For instance, AI algorithms can analyze large datasets from various sources, including satellite imagery, weather records, and sensor data, to create more precise models of water flow, sediment transport, and contaminant dispersion.

# Innovations in GIS Integration

Geographic Information Systems (GIS) play a crucial role in HydroGeo modeling by providing a platform to visualize and analyze spatial data. The latest GIS technologies, such as cloud-based platforms and web APIs, make it easier to share and collaborate on models. These platforms allow users to access real-time data, perform complex analyses, and create detailed visualizations, all from anywhere with an internet connection.
